Is Anne Dewavrin Married? Relationship

Anne was wed to Bernard Arnault on April 7, 1973, in Nord, Hauts-de-France. Primarily because Bernard is currently the wealthiest man in the world, Anne is taken aback by his unexpected popularity.

His current net worth is $155 billion. He surpassed Amancio Ortega of Zara to attain the status of fashion industry magnate in April 1999.

Bernard, a French industrialist, is the chairman and chief executive officer of the world’s largest manufacturer of luxury products, LVMH Moet Hennessy Louis Vuitton SA.

Arnault obtained his engineering degree from the École Polytechnique in Paris. The couple granted birth to two offspring. The date of birth of their son, Antoine Arnault, is June 4, 1977.

Their daughter Delphine Arnault, who was born on April 4, 1975, serves as the CEO of Berluti. In addition, she operates a business.

Additionally, both Anne’s daughter and son are married. Anne has grandchildren as well. Elisa, Maxim, and Roman. Ultimately, Anne and Bernard divorced in 1990 due to the dissolution of their marriage.

How did Anne Dewavrin start her Professional Career?

By her matrimonial union with Bernard Arnault, the richest individual in France and the third-wealthiest individual globally, Anne Dewavrin rose to prominence. Anne operates her own company. Following her divorce from Bernard, she entered into matrimony with Patrice de Maistre.

Initially, Bernard Arnault entered the manufacturing industry by joining his father’s company. Following a tenure of five years, he persuaded his father to divest the construction division and embark on an enterprise in real estate.

Initially, operating under the name Férinel, the nascent enterprise manufactured customized lodging options. He assumed the role of corporation director in 1974 and was appointed CEO in 1977. His father appointed him president of the company in 1979.
